Victoria Beckham's 14-year-old daughter Harper has put her plans for a debut skincare and makeup range on hold as she focuses on her GCSE examinations .

The GCSE Priority

According to Victoria Beckham,Harper is currently concentrating on her GCSEs, leaving the beauty launch plans on hold.

The fashion designer, 52, explained in a recnt appearance on The Sunday Times Style podcast that Harper's education takes priority over the beauty launch.

HIKU BY Harper: A Beauty Dream on Hold

The planned beauty launch, HIKU BY Harper, was sparked by trademark hurdles and a personal battle with acne.

Harper had expressed a strong passion for cosmetics and had even drafted PowerPoint presentations for the brand .
